I run a Stroud cam lock harness. My shoulder straps wrap around the cross bar, my lap belts use the factory mounting points (had to open up the holes in the lap belt brackets alittle), and the sub belt is wraped around a Wolfe crotch strap bracket. This way I didn't have to pop any holes in the car. I got my harness' from Wolfe Race Craft. I started with Corbeau seats but switched to Kirkeys, I actually just put them in today. If you go with Kirkeys, seat brackets will have to be fabricated.
